-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: SHA1 Christopher Faylor wrote: | On Wed, Jun 18, 2008 at 12:25:17PM -0400, Robert Pendell wrote: |> Christopher Faylor wrote: |>> On Tue, Jun 17, 2008 at 01:32:29PM -0400, Robert Pendell wrote: |>>> Christopher Faylor wrote: |>>>> I am running a new mirror checker on the cygwin web site. It should do |>>>> a much better job of finding valid mirrors. The mirror check process |>>>> now runs multiple times a day validating that files on the mirrors are |>>>> up to date. |>>>> |>>>> There is still a hole between the time where package maintainer updates |>>>> a package on the main cygwin site and the mirror grabs the package. So |>>>> we still can't guarantee that the mirror list contains 100% accurate |>>>> data. Hopefully we won't have situations where mirrors are just |>>>> garbage now, however. On closer inspection of the old mirror checker, |>>>> I found a few cases where it would interpret information incorrectly |>>>> when it was scanning a mirror for valid files, leaving the mirror list |>>>> in an incorrect state. |>>>> |>>>> The new mirror checker returns better errors so I was actually able to |>>>> resurrect a few mirrors which had moved the location of the cygwin |>>>> mirror directory on their site. There are also a few mirrors which |>>>> inexplicably only contain a subset of the cygwin release directory. I |>>>> guess I'll eventually just remove them from the master list entirely. |>>>> |>>>> If you think there are problems with the new list please continue to |>>>> send them here.
